First-click attribution
First-click acknowledgment versions credit rating conversions to the channel that initially presented a potential customer to your brand. This technique permits marketers to better comprehend the recognition phase of their marketing funnel and enhance advertising investing.
This version is easy to execute and comprehend, and it supplies presence right into the channels that are most effective at drawing in preliminary customer focus. Nonetheless, it ignores subsequent interactions and can lead to a misalignment of advertising approaches and purposes.
As an example, let's say that a potential client finds your service with a Facebook advertisement. If you make use of a first-click acknowledgment version, all credit for the sale would go to the Facebook ad. This could cause you to prioritize Facebook ads over other marketing efforts, such as branded search or retargeting campaigns.
Last-click attribution
The Last-Click attribution model assigns conversion credit scores to the final advertising channel or touchpoint that the client communicated with before making a purchase. While this method provides simplicity, it can fail to consider how various other advertising and marketing initiatives affected the customer trip. Various other designs, such as the Time-Decay and Data-Driven Attribution designs, provide more accurate insights into advertising and marketing efficiency.
Last-Click Acknowledgment is straightforward to establish and can streamline ROI computations for your advertising campaigns. However, it can overlook vital payments from various other advertising channels. For instance, a customer may see your Facebook advertisement, after that click a Google ad before making a purchase. The last Google advertisement obtains the conversion credit score, however the preliminary Facebook ad played an important duty in the consumer journey.

U-shaped attribution
Unlike straight attribution versions, U-shaped attribution acknowledges the value of both awareness and conversion. It appoints 40% of credit report to the first and last touchpoint, while the remaining 20% is dispersed uniformly among the middle interactions. This design is a good option for online marketers that intend to prioritize list building and conversion while acknowledging the importance of center touchpoints.
